Understanding the Implications of PO2 Levels Below 60 mmHg

When you’re delving into the clinical world of respiratory health, it’s crucial to understand the significance of arterial blood gases—particularly the PO2 levels. You might wonder, what happens when a patient’s PO2 dips below 60 mmHg?

Well, let’s break it down! A PO2 level less than 60 mmHg is far from a minor detail; it’s actually a sign of significant hypoxemia. This is a fancy way of saying there’s just not enough oxygen in the blood, and trust me, that’s a serious situation. Think of it like trying to run a marathon with no air—your body simply can’t function properly.

Signs of Trouble

So, what does this really indicate? A low PO2 level like this signifies respiratory failure. Now you might be thinking, “How can someone get to this point?” Let me explain. Respiratory failure can stem from various conditions like chronic obstructive pulmonary disease (COPD), pneumonia, or even something as simple as severe asthma. Each of these conditions messes with the way our lungs exchange gases, leading to that dreaded hypoxemia.

Why Does it Matter?

Why should we care about these oxygen levels? Because low oxygen affects everything in our body. We need oxygen for cellular metabolism, right? When the oxygen level plummets, it can set off a cascade of problems throughout our systems. Essentially, it's like leaving your car in neutral on a steep hill; without proper fuel—oxygen, in this analogy—you’re going to end up in a heap of trouble.

In clinical practice, if you see a patient with a PO2 under 60, your priority should be determining whether they need supplemental oxygen or even mechanical ventilation. These interventions aren’t just optional—they’re lifesaving. Making quick assessments can make all the difference in patient outcomes.

Interventions and Next Steps

So, if a patient's PO2 is on the low side, what steps should follow? For starters, immediate assessment is key. Here’s a quick run-through on how to respond:

  • Oxygen Therapy: This might range from simple nasal cannulas to more intensive measures, like CPAP or mechanical ventilation.

  • Assessment: Closely monitor the patient’s vital signs and overall condition. Understanding their medical history can provide clues to their current status.

  • Communication: Always relay this information to your healthcare team. Collaboration is essential for effective treatment.
